Introduction After completing 12th with Science (PCB/PCM), many students plan to enter the pharmaceutical field . The most common confusion among pharmacy aspirants is choosing between D.Pharm (Diploma in Pharmacy) and B.Pharm (Bachelor of Pharmacy) . Both courses lead to careers in pharmacy, but they differ significantly in duration, eligibility, job roles, salary, career growth, and future scope . This detailed article will help you clearly understand D.Pharm vs B.Pharm so you can make the right career decision based on your goals. What is D.Pharm (Diploma in Pharmacy)? D.Pharm is a 2-year diploma course designed to train students for entry-level pharmacy jobs , mainly in retail and hospital pharmacies.
